A British woman who was kidnapped and held hostage for 13 years has told her story for the first time in a new book called Secret Slave.
Anna (name changed to protect her identity) was kidnapped just two days after her 15th birthday. Confined to a room, her only outings were to a hospital to birth four children which she claims her captor sold.
I excerpts of her book, obtained by The Mirror, Anna explains that as a teen, she was staying with a friend of her mum’s. She was captured by an Asian taxi man, Malik, who worked with that friend.
“If anyone showed me affection I grabbed hold of that,” Anna explained.
“Malik would ask me how I was. It was nice to have someone interested.”
“When he asked me to go back to his house for tea he knew no one would miss me.”
“There are a lot of vulnerable girls like I was. This could be happening on any street.”
Malik kept Anna confined to a room.
“I can still see that bedroom, the corner where I would rock in pain. Although after a while I stopped feeling pain, I think my body shut down,” she says.
“And I can smell it – the can I used as a toilet, the garlic he reeked of. I got to the point where I didn’t know what life was.”
Anna explains that Malik disguised her in cultural dress.
“Malik dressed me in his culture’s clothes, dyed my hair black, made me wear a scarf and keep my head down. When he spoke for me they thought it was a cultural thing. And I think people are scared to be accused of discrimination.”
Anna explains that Malik lived with his brothers, their wives and children. He called her a “Filthy white s***” and said he would make her is own. Malik proceeded to rape the teen nightly and began prostituting her to other men, including his brothers.
The only time the abuse stopped was when Anna fell pregnant. She quickly realized that this was because Malik could profit on the sale of her boy children.
She describes feeling happy when she realized she was pregnant.
“When you feel a baby move in your stomach you feel you have someone with you, you are not alone.”
But once the child was born, Malik took him away.
“I barely held any of my babies, I did not get the chance to be a mother to them,” Anna says.
“I do not know where they are,” Anna reveals.
Anna managed to escape when a health visitor came to the house. Anna wrote a note saying Help Me next to a date. The health worker picked it up and replied with a note reading:
“I will ring the house phone three times when I’m outside.”
Anna escaped and alerted the police to her situation. By that time, Malik had also rang claiming his wife had run away and that she had severe mental health issues.
Anna is now 44 and had been free for 16 years.
